Symfony разработка

Студия Интерактивного Дизайна разрабатывает нестандартные веб-сайты и интернет приложения на базе PHP фреймворка Symfony.

 

Что мы понимаем под “нестандартным веб-сайтом или интернет приложением”?

Если проект имеет сложную бизнес-логику и не может быть качественно реализован на коробочных версиях популярных PHP фреймворков (Wordpress, Drupal, Prestashop ит.д.), предполагаемый срок реализации проекта составляет не менее 4 месяцев и количество нормо-часов не менее 800, то  мы называем такой проект нестандартным.

 

Почему для нестандартных интернет приложений мы используем Symfony?

  • Symfony самый надежный и стабильный PHP фреймворк на сегодняшний день. Symfony имеет прогнозируемый план выхода версий на ближайшие шесть лет.
  • Symfony обеспечивает быструю разработку за счет применения готовых бандлов (модулей).
  • Symfony создан разработчиками как раз для создания больших проектов и проектов с нестандартной логикой.
  • Мы имеем хороший опыт в разработке проектов на базе PHP фреймворка Symfony
  • Symfony используют такие всемирно известные проекты как Yahoo!, Delicious, Joomla, Magento, Silex, Doctrine, Laravel и многие другие.


 

Что делаем мы :

Полный цикл разработки интернет приложения или веб сайта на Symfony. Этот цикл может включать в себя:

  • Участие в разработке технических требований
  • Техническую экспертизу, подбор и обоснование технологий и решений
  • Участие в разработке технического задания
  • Разработка UI/UX и графического дизайна
  • Frontend дизайн
  • Backend разработку
  • Тестирование
  • Документирование
  • Deploy и поддержку
 

Наш опыт:

  • Разработка информационных порталов
  • Разработка систем управления информацией
  • Разработка системы управления сайтами
  • Разработка backend для мобильных приложений
  • Разработка интернет-магазинов и каталогов
  • Разработка корпоративных сайтов
  • Управление микропроцессорными системами через Веб


 

Некоторые особенности разработки Symfony проектов в Студии Интерактивного Дизайна:

  • Вся разработка ведется под системой контроля версий  GIT (обычно мы работаем под GitLab)
  • Заказчик (по договоренности ) имеет постоянный доступ к репозиториям проекта.
  • Для планирования, взаимодействия с Заказчиком и контроля выполнения проекта мы используем JIRA.
  • Во время разработки мы разворачиваем тестовый сервер, на котором Заказчик может контролировать ход выполнения проекта.
  • Мы практикуем методологию бережливой разработки.